Annan Athletic are in the market for a new goalkeeper after they agreed a deal for Dougie Calder to join junior side Bellshill Athletic.Ex-Motherwell keeper Calder made four appearances in Annan's maiden Third Division campaign after they joined the Scottish Football League last year.
"The club wish Dougie all the best with his new club," said an Annan spokesman.
Meanwhile, player/assistant manager Derek Townsley has signed a new one-year contract at Galabank.
Manager Harry Cairney is in discussions with several parties with the aim of finding a replacement for Calder.
